MetaMask(メタマスク)で複数ネットワークを利用する方法まとめ
近年、ブロックチェーン技術の発展に伴い、仮想通貨や分散型アプリケーション(DApp)へのアクセスが一般化しています。その中でも、MetaMaskは最も広く利用されているウェブウォレットの一つとして、ユーザーの間で高い評価を受けています。特に、複数のブロックチェーンネットワークを効率的に切り替えながら利用できる点が、開発者や投資家にとって極めて重要な利点です。本記事では、MetaMaskを用いて複数のネットワークを利用するための詳細な手順と、実務的な活用法について、専門的かつ体系的に解説します。
1. MetaMaskとは?基本機能と役割
MetaMaskは、ブラウザ拡張機能として提供されるデジタルウォレットであり、ユーザーがブロックチェーン上の資産を安全に管理し、分散型アプリケーション(DApp)と直接やり取りできるようにするツールです。主にイーサリアム(Ethereum)ネットワークをベースとしていますが、他のコンセプトに基づくネットワークにも対応しており、マルチチェーン環境における重要なハブ的存在です。
主な機能には以下のものがあります:
- 仮想通貨の送受信(ETH、ERC-20トークンなど)
- スマートコントラクトとのインタラクション
- アカウントの作成・管理(プライベートキーの暗号化保管)
- ネットワークの切り替えによる多様なチェーンへのアクセス
- 署名処理とトランザクションの確認
これらの機能により、ユーザーは自身の資産を完全に制御しながら、あらゆるブロックチェーンサービスにアクセスすることが可能になります。特に「複数ネットワーク」の切り替え機能は、異なるブロックチェーンの特性を活かした戦略的運用に不可欠です。
2. 複数ネットワークの重要性と利用シーン
ブロックチェーン技術の進化に伴い、イーサリアム以外にも多くのパブリックチェーンが登場しています。各チェーンは独自の特徴を持ち、特定の用途に最適化されています。例えば:
- イーサリアム(Ethereum):スマートコントラクトの先駆け、最高のセキュリティとネットワーク効果を持つ
- ポリゴン(Polygon):低コスト・高速なトランザクションを実現し、ゲームやミームコインのプラットフォームとして人気
- バイナンススマートチェーン(BSC):急速な取引処理速度と安価な手数料で、ステーキングやデファイ(DeFi)活動に適している
- オーダーブロックチェーン(Avalanche):サブネット構造により、高スループットと柔軟なカスタマイズが可能
- クロスチェーンネットワーク(Arbitrum、Optimism):イーサリアムの拡張性を高めるレイヤー2プロトコルとして注目
このような多様なチェーンが存在する背景において、単一のネットワークに依存するのではなく、目的に応じて最適なチェーンを選択することが重要となります。たとえば、大きな資金移動にはイーサリアムの安全性を活かす一方で、頻繁な小額取引にはポリゴンやBSCの低コストを活用するといった戦略が可能です。
このように、MetaMaskの「複数ネットワーク切り替え機能」は、ユーザーが効率的かつ柔軟に複数のブロックチェーン環境を統合的に操作できる基盤を提供します。
3. MetaMaskでのネットワーク切り替え手順(詳細ガイド)
以下に、MetaMaskを用いて複数のネットワークに切り替えるための具体的な手順を段階的に紹介します。このプロセスは、初心者から熟練者まで共通して適用可能な標準的手順です。
3.1 ブラウザ拡張機能のインストールと初期設定
まず、MetaMaskの公式サイト(https://metamask.io)からブラウザ拡張(Chrome、Firefox、Edgeなど)をダウンロード・インストールします。インストール後、拡張機能アイコンをクリックして初期セットアップを開始します。
初期設定では、新しいウォレットの作成または既存ウォレットの復元が求められます。ここでは「新しいウォレットを作成」を選択し、強固なパスワードを設定した上で、12語のリカバリーフレーズ(バックアップコード)を記録・保存してください。これは、アカウントを再取得するための唯一の手段であり、絶対に漏らさないよう注意が必要です。
3.2 ネットワークの追加:公式リストからの選択
MetaMaskのダッシュボードで右上にある「ネットワーク」ドロップダウンメニューを開きます。ここで、現在接続中のネットワーク(例:イーサリアムメインネット)が表示されます。
「ネットワークを追加」というボタンをクリックすると、新規ネットワークの設定画面が開きます。以下の情報を入力します:
- ネットワーク名:例「Polygon Mainnet」
- RPC URL:例「https://polygon-rpc.com」
- チェーンID:137(Polygonの正式チェーンID)
- シンボル:MATIC
- Explorer URL:例「https://polygonscan.com」
情報入力後、「保存」ボタンを押すことで、新しいネットワークが追加され、即座に切り替え可能になります。
3.3 オンラインで公開されているネットワークの自動読み込み
MetaMaskは、一部の主要ネットワークを事前に登録済みとして提供しており、ユーザーが手動で追加しなくても、簡単に切り替えられるようになっています。たとえば、以下のようなネットワークは公式リストに含まれており、ドロップダウンから選択するだけで使用可能です:
- Ethereum Mainnet
- Polygon (Matic)
- Binance Smart Chain (BNB)
- Avalanche C-Chain
- Optimism
- Arbitrum One
これらのネットワークは、公式サイトやMetaMaskのドキュメントで最新情報が確認できます。定期的な更新により、新しいチェーンも迅速にサポートされる仕組みとなっています。
3.4 自動切り替えの設定と便利な機能
MetaMaskでは、特定のDAppがどのネットワークで動作するかを検知し、自動的にネットワークを切り替える機能も備えています。たとえば、あるDeFiプラットフォームがPolygon上で稼働している場合、そのページにアクセスした際に「MetaMaskが自動的にネットワークを切り替えます」といった通知が表示され、ユーザーが承認することで自動的に接続されます。
ただし、この自動切り替えはセキュリティリスクを伴う可能性があるため、常に「ネットワークの変更が意図したものかどうか」を確認する必要があります。特に、偽のネットワークに誘導される「ネットワークスイッチフィッシング」攻撃に注意が必要です。
4. 実務的な活用例:複数ネットワークの戦略的利用
以下に、実際の業務や投資活動における複数ネットワークの活用例をご紹介します。
4.1 DeFi(分散型金融)でのネットワーク最適化
DeFi分野では、さまざまなチェーンで異なる利回りや手数料が設定されています。たとえば、イーサリアム上では高額なガス代がかかるため、小規模なステーキングや流動性プールへの参加は困難です。一方、ポリゴンやBSCでは非常に低い手数料で同様の操作が可能になります。
そのため、ユーザーは「高利回りのプロジェクトはBSCで、大規模な資産管理はイーサリアムで行う」といった戦略を採用します。MetaMaskを使えば、これらのネットワーク間を瞬時に切り替え、最適な条件で資産を運用できます。
4.2 NFTの購入と転売におけるコスト管理
NFT市場では、イーサリアム上の取引が主流ですが、高額なガス代がネックとなることも少なくありません。特に、大量の購入や短期売買を行う場合は、コストが膨らむリスクがあります。
そこで、ポリゴンやセピア(Sepolia Testnet)などのテストネットや低コストチェーンで試行錯誤を行い、その後、実際の取引はイーサリアムメインネットで行うという運用パターンが一般的です。MetaMaskのネットワーク切り替え機能により、このプロセスを効率的に実現できます。
4.3 クロスチェーンアプリケーションとの連携
最近の分散型アプリケーションは、複数のチェーンを統合的に利用する「クロスチェーン」設計が主流になりつつあります。たとえば、あるゲームが「イーサリアムでキャラクターを所有し、ポリゴンでバトルを実施」といった仕組みを採用している場合、ユーザーはそれぞれのチェーンに適したネットワークで接続する必要があります。
MetaMaskはこうした多チェーン環境を支えるための基盤として、無縁な接続を可能にします。ユーザーは、ゲームの設定画面から「チェーンを切り替える」ボタンをクリックするだけで、必要なネットワークに自動的に移行できます。
5. セキュリティとトラブルシューティング
複数ネットワークを利用する際には、いくつかのセキュリティリスクに注意が必要です。以下に代表的な注意点と対策を紹介します。
5.1 不正ネットワークの識別
悪意のある第三者が、似たような名称のネットワーク(例:「Polygon Mainnet」→「Polygont Mainnet」)を偽装し、ユーザーを誤ったチェーンに接続させる「ネットワークフィッシング」攻撃が存在します。このような攻撃に遭わないためには、公式のチェーン情報を事前に確認し、正しいRPC URLやチェーンIDを正確に入力することが必須です。
5.2 無関係なネットワークへの誤操作
誤って別のネットワークに接続してしまうと、そのネットワーク上のトークンや資産が失われるリスクがあります。たとえば、イーサリアム上で保有していたETHを、誤ってポリゴンに送金した場合、それは「無効な送金」となり、元に戻せません。
そのため、ネットワーク切り替え時には、必ず「現在のネットワーク名」を確認し、目的のチェーンであることを再確認してください。また、送金前には「送金先のチェーン」も明確に把握しておくことが重要です。
5.3 ネットワークの不具合対応
ネットワークのメンテナンスや障害発生時は、トランザクションが処理されない、あるいは遅延する場合があります。このような状況では、ユーザーが急いで別のネットワークに切り替える必要が出てくることもあります。
MetaMaskでは、ネットワークの状態をリアルタイムで表示する機能があり、異常が発生している場合には警告メッセージが表示されます。これにより、ユーザーは迅速に状況を把握し、代替手段を検討できます。
6. まとめ
本稿では、MetaMaskを用いた複数ネットワークの利用方法について、技術的・実務的視点から詳細に解説しました。複数のブロックチェーンネットワークを効果的に使い分けることは、現代のデジタル資産管理において極めて重要なスキルです。MetaMaskは、その操作性の高さと汎用性の優れさから、個人ユーザーから企業レベルの運用まで幅広く活用されています。
特に、ネットワークの切り替え機能は、コスト最適化、セキュリティ強化、そして高度なデジタルエコシステムへのアクセスを可能にする重要なツールです。しかし、同時にネットワークフィッシングや誤操作といったリスクも伴うため、知識と注意深さが求められます。
今後のブロックチェーン環境はさらに多様化が進むと考えられます。その中で、MetaMaskを活用したマルチチェーン戦略は、ユーザーの自律性と自由度を高める鍵となるでしょう。正確な情報収集、慎重な操作習慣、そして継続的な学習が、安全かつ効果的な利用の秘訣です。
最後に、すべてのユーザーが自身の資産を守り、効率的に活用できるよう、本記事が参考になれば幸いです。


